Installed fine, and at first glance doesn't seem to have any glaring issues. Others have said that the Windows Hello animation is faster and that you can turn off the glance-screen while charging too. Not confirmed this myself as yet, but have no reason to doubt these features are there. Although having glance always on when charging is a good thing I thought... means I can use it as my bedside clock when it's on charge overnight.

Some smarter looking graphics/icons when forwarding emails. Some issues with photos, choosing/adjusting the HDR effect on a photo caused the photo app to crash back to the desktop, not a show stopper, and doesn't happen every time. There was some corruption in the headers for WhatsApp but this seem to have sorted itself out for now. Aside from those minor things, it seems pretty good so far, certainly seems stable. Battery life seems normal, not any worse than before. I started the update this morning when the battery was full, the update and usage throughout the day so far have left the battery at 46%, but it has been off charge since about 7.00AM and was not on charge during the update, it's 14.30 here now, so down a bit on what it would normally be but that's to be expected due to the update being quite taxing on the battery when installing.

I check for Updates this morning and saw the “Localization for English” appear on the Update Status Page and a "Download" notification looming within. I read that Windows Central recommended "NOT" to install, so I let it sit there; I inadvertently plugged my 950XL in, to charge. After about 1/2 hour on the charger I remembered that the update said it would "download" the next time I plugged into a charger, so I immediately opened the Update Page (to stop the download hopefully) and had an "Error Message" with a "Retry" button. I thought I would retry the update, and hopefully "cancel" the download, to wait for further clarification....after I hit the "Retry", the phone did its check and came back as "Device is up to date". I then checked the current build, and I remain at 14977; so, apparently the update has cancelled itself?
